589. To ask the Minister for Environment, Community and Local Government the options available to persons (details supplied) currently residing in Oxford in England, but who, due to age and ill health, wish to return to Loughrea in County Galway where they were born; the agencies that are in a position to offer advice, guidance and assistance regarding their housing needs; and if he will make a statement on the matter. [24686/15]

Photo of Alan KellyAlan Kelly (Tipperary North, Labour)
Link to this: Individually | In context | Oireachtas source

I understand that Safe Home Programme Ltd, a charitable organisation supported by the Department of Foreign Affairs Emigrant Support Programme, provides an information and advisory service for anyone considering a move back to the State, including information on their housing options. To apply for housing under the service, applicant s must meet certain criteria including an inability to provide accommodation from their own resources. Further information is available on the organisation’s website at the link below.
